Fault tolerance refers to the ability of an IT system to continue operations despite the occurrence of hardware or software failures. It involves designing systems that can automatically detect faults and maintain functionality without significant disruption. Key components of fault tolerance include redundancy, failover mechanisms, and error handling. For businesses that rely on IT support outsourcing, implementing fault-tolerant systems is crucial to ensure continuous service delivery and minimize downtime. These systems are essential for maintaining operational continuity in various business environments.

Implementing Fault Tolerance Measures
To ensure business continuity and protect against system failures, small and medium enterprises (SMEs) should implement effective fault tolerance measures. Two essential strategies include redundant systems and data backups, as well as automatic failover mechanisms.
Redundant Systems and Data Backups
Redundant systems are designed to take over in the event of a failure in the primary system. This minimizes downtime and ensures that operations can continue uninterrupted. Data backups are equally important, as they protect valuable information from loss due to system failures.
Having a comprehensive data backup plan is critical. It should include daily backups, off-site storage, and regular testing to verify the integrity of the data.
Automatic Failover Mechanisms
Automatic failover mechanisms allow systems to switch to a backup component seamlessly when a failure is detected in the primary system. This process is essential for maintaining service availability and minimizing the impact of unexpected outages.
Regular testing of automatic failover systems is necessary to ensure they function correctly during an actual failure event. This proactive approach significantly enhances the reliability and efficiency of IT operations in SMEs.

Best Practices for Maintaining Fault Tolerant Systems
Maintaining fault-tolerant systems requires careful attention and proactive measures. By implementing regular audits and training employees, small and medium enterprises (SMEs) can enhance the reliability of their IT infrastructure.
Regular System Audits and Testing
Conducting regular system audits and tests is essential for identifying potential vulnerabilities in fault-tolerant setups. These audits help ensure that all components function correctly and that back-up systems are in place and operational.
The following table outlines common audit activities and their recommended frequency:
Audit Activity | Recommended Frequency |
System Performance Review | Quarterly |
Backup Recovery Testing | Monthly |
Security Vulnerability Assessment | Bi-annually |
Hardware and Software Inventory | Annually |
Regular testing of automated failover mechanisms also occurs to ensure they activate as intended during outages, minimizing downtime and improving user confidence.
